Epsin 1 Antibody (F-7) is a mouse monoclonal IgG1 antibody that detects Epsin 1 in human samples through various applications including western blotting (WB), immunoprecipitation (IP), immunofluorescence (IF), immunohistochemistry, and en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ay (ELISA). Epsin 1 plays a crucial role in the endocytic process, particularly in the formation of Clathrin-coated vesicles, which are essential for the internalization of membrane proteins and lipids. Epsin 1 is primarily located at the leading edge of vesicular coated pits, where Epsin 1 facilitates the bending of the membrane, a critical step in endocytosis. The presence of an epsin N-terminal homology (ENTH) domain and a Clathrin-binding motif within Epsin 1 underscores Epsin 1′s importance in the recruitment of Clathrin and other accessory proteins, thereby regulating the dynamics of vesicle formation. Additionally, Epsin 1 undergoes post-translational modifications, including phosphorylation, which can influence Epsin 1′s interaction with other proteins and functional activity during cellular processes. Epsin 1′s ability to interact with proteins such as Eps15 and Clathrin highlights Epsin 1′s integral role in the endocytic machinery, making Epsin 1 a vital component for maintaining cellular homeostasis and signaling pathways.
